    How Snow Machines Work

    Snow machines, also known as snowmakers, work by combining water and compressed air. As the water passes through a nozzle under high pressure, it is atomized into tiny droplets. The droplets then encounter a stream of cold air, which freezes them into ice crystals. These crystals accumulate on the ground, gradually building a layer of snow.

    Snowmaking Efficiency

    The efficiency of snowmaking depends on several factors: *

    Temperature

    Snowmaking is most efficient when the temperature is below freezing. *

    Humidity

    Lower humidity levels allow for more rapid evaporation, resulting in higher snow production. *

    Water Source

    The availability of a reliable water source is crucial for continuous snowmaking.
